CMCSA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

2,295 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Comcast (CMCSA)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$111B — down 4.6% from $117B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 172 funds closed out of CMCSA and 144 opened new positions — a net loss of 28 holders — while 1,049 trimmed existing stakes and 866 added.

The largest buyer was Dodge & Cox, adding an estimated $590M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$659M.
